Canada has found itself at the centre of a trio of proclamations signed by the American president, that aim to further punish a decision to keep retaliating against the Trump administration's tariffs.
U.S. President Donald Trump signed three executive orders Monday, placing new 50 per cent tariffs on hundreds of Canadian exports.
These tariffs will take affect in 30 days, and are impacting almost everything and violating the current Canada-U.S.-Mexico Agreement on free trade (CUSMA).
Canadian goods affected include alcohol, dairy and agricultural products, as well as furniture, paper, hockey sticks and other gear, cement, clothing and textiles.
